    Basically taking the current overhead and making some adjustments so the movement is 'layered' is what I have in mind. Not all paths will be connected directly, but some of the main ones will; others will only connect to specific paths and not the main ones. My idea is to have the ground layer, which is what I have now, and is accessible to vehicles (in most places) and infantry entirely. There is also a middle layer, which spans between the cliffs every here and there, bridging some routes and allowing an overview of others. This will be useful for shifting main attacks or losing pursuers when you have the flag. Then there's also a top layer, made up primarily of the narrow footbridge-like structures seen in Halo, Danger Canyon, Infinity, etc., intended for infantry moving from one overwatch position to the next. All along the length of the main canyon and at some of the wider points in the secondary one (where the temple is), paths will run along the rockface to allow access to various stationary guns and firing positions. The aircraft will, of course, have access to the entire area.

    There will be certain points at ground level where caves and so on open from one path to another, but the majority of switching will be done via the bridging tunnels. There will also be a rather large network of small tunnels and natural caverns leading to good sniper and observation positions all around the plain, but they will be accessible only by infantry. The Loyalists hold the advantage of the high ground and a clear line of sight across more or less their entire area, but they have very little cover aside from the base complex itself and a few small defiles or groves of small trees. I want to keep a fairly large number of comparatively narrow paths with towering cliffs criss-crossed by bridges high above so it really exudes that sense of vertigo that only Halo can; however there will be some fairly open areas. While the layout you've got there would be perfect for a standard-sized map about the same dimensions as BG, it strikes me as beeing a little off in terms of proportions and complexity for something closer to the size of several 'normal' maps put together. I do get what you're saying though, and I'll certainly add more ways of crossing from one path to another as that helps the atmosphere I'm aiming for anyway.

    I had one in mind, but I wasn't too keen on it because then it would basically suck all the combat away from the surface. If you give someone a stealthy, safe way, then they aren't going to take the risky and open one. The other issue was that even if it did get you along the canyons to safety, you're still put out in a very open place. In all honesty you're probably better off taking the open canyons than you are an underground tunnel or cave, because at least you'll have vehicles capable of picking off aircraft around you.

    That said, there will be some underground areas for the infantry, in particular under the structures.
